Nathan Mason, of Juliette, got this 21-lb., four-bearded gobbler on April 6. The beards were 9 1/2, 7 7/16, 6 and 5 1/16 inches. “He was gobbling hard straight off the roost,” Nathan said. “He came into a food plot about 20 minutes after fly down. I called in a hen, and he was just a few seconds behind her.”
